矢大臣山

The highest peak in Iwaki City, offering a scenic hike through beech forests to a summit observation deck and shrine.

Mount Yadaijin
Σ64 CC BY 3.0 resized via Wikimedia Commons

What it is

  • The highest peak in Iwaki City, standing at 965 meters above sea level.
  • A mountain located in the central Abukuma Highlands on the border of Tamura, Ono, and Iwaki.
  • A natural site featuring a second-class triangulation point at its northern end.

What to see

  • A large observation deck positioned just below the mountain summit.
  • A small shrine located at the northern end of the peak.
  • Broadleaf trees including beech growing along the various mountain trails.
  • Wild azaleas and eastern daisies blooming near the summit area.

When to go

  • Spring is the best time to see the wild azaleas and eastern daisies.

Getting there

  • The Yuzawa trailhead is accessible from Ono Town.
  • The Kobirai trailhead is located within Iwaki City.
  • Climbing to the summit takes approximately one hour and twenty minutes.
